比特币的秘密密匙控制比特币?这是管理的关键,是由数字和小写字母组成的64个字符串。秘密密匙通过生成公开密匙、计算地址、签名等来保证比特币交易的正当性。
1.准备好你的私钥:确保你的私钥是正确的。秘密密匙是64个字的字符串。
2.创建钱包实例:使用钱包管理库初始化新的钱包实例。例如,在使用BiX库的时候。
```皮霍
from big .walle impor walle
walle walle。
```
解密私钥:如果你的私钥是加密的,你需要提供密码来解密。例如这样。
```皮霍
decryp_privae_key walle.decryp_privae_key('your_password')。
```
4.交易生成:使用私钥生成新的交易。这通常需要指定比特币的接收地址、汇款金额以及其他可能的交易细节。
```皮霍
from big .rasacio impor Trasacio
1 a 1 zp ep 5 qgefi 2 dmptftl 5 slmv 7 divfa o _ address ' '
0.01
x Trasacio。
x.a_ipu (ipu_scripwalle. ge_publicy_key_scrip (decryped_privae_key)。
oup_scripwalle . ge_pubice_key_scrip (decryped_privae_key),
amouamou。
```
5.发送交易:为了将交易广播到比特币网络,你需要将生成的交易发送到网络。这通常需要创建与比特币节点连接的客户端,并通过该客户端广播交易。
```皮霍
from bix.clie impor BicoiClie
假设clie BicoiClie(‘localhos’,8333)使用本地运行的节点。
clie.sed_raw_rasacio(x.erialize())。
```
6.交易确认:交易发送后,可能需要等待几秒到几分钟才能在网络上确认交易。这是通过检查交易在区块链上的状态而实现的。
需要注意的是,这只是非常简单的例子,实际上可能需要处理网络连接、错误处理、交易费用等更复杂的细节。另外,秘密密匙一旦丢失或泄露,相关比特币就无法回收或控制,这一点需要注意。